No kings: A National Day of defiance Unites Communities Across the Country

On June 14, communities from coast to coast gathered for the No Kings National Day of Defiance — a coordinated, peaceful protest against rising authoritarianism, political corruption, and attacks on civil liberties. Organized in opposition to the growing influence of Trump and his allies, the day was not about spectacle, but solidarity.

Marchers held flags, banners, and signs reclaiming American values from would-be kings and oligarchs. They showed up where he didn’t — to say no thrones, no crowns, no kings. The message was unified, bold, and unwavering: democracy belongs to the people.
